区块链是一种去中心化的分布式账本技术,能够在不需要中央权威的情况下,让多个参与者共同维护数据的透明性和安全性。最初,区块链技术应用于比特币等加密货币,但随着其逐渐被更多行业接受,应用范围也在不断扩大。
区块链的核心特性包括安全性、透明性、不可篡改性和去中心化,这使得它在金融、供应链管理、物联网、医疗健康、版权保护等多个领域都有着广泛的应用前景。
### 外包业务的兴起外包业务是企业在资源有限的情况下,将某些业务或任务外包给专业公司或团队完成的模式。在区块链行业,由于技术门槛较高,人力资源紧缺,很多公司选择将部分开发或运营任务外包给专门的区块链公司。这种模式不仅能够节省成本,还能利用专业团队的技术优势,提高项目质量。
随着全球对区块链技术需求的增长,越来越多的区块链公司开始提供外包服务,满足不同行业客户的需求。这些服务包括但不限于区块链开发、智能合约开发、系统集成、商业咨询等。
### 区块链公司的外包服务类别 1. **区块链开发** 2. **智能合约开发** 3. **咨询服务** 4. **技术支持与维护** 5. **系统集成** #### 区块链开发区块链开发是区块链公司外包业务中最常见的一项。它包括从底层的区块链平台开发到应用层的DApp(分布式应用程序)开发。许多企业可能缺乏开发区块链所需的特定技能,因此外包开发可以帮助他们迅速获得所需的技术支持。
区块链开发通常包括以下几个环节:
- **项目需求分析**:了解客户的需求,制定开发计划。 - **区块链架构设计**:根据需求选择合适的区块链框架,如Ethereum、Hyperledger等。 - **开发与测试**:进行代码编写及测试,确保系统的安全与稳定性。 - **部署与维护**:上线后进行持续监控与维护,确保系统的运作顺利。 #### 智能合约开发智能合约是运行在区块链上的自动化合约,能够根据预定条件自动执行合约条款。智能合约开发是区块链外包业务的重要组成部分,许多企业希望通过智能合约来提高业务效率、降低信任成本。
外包智能合约开发时,区块链公司会负责以下几个方面:
- **合约设计**:根据业务需求设计合约的条款和逻辑。 - **编码与测试**:编写智能合约代码并进行全面测试,确保其安全性和正确性。 - **审核与部署**:在发布前进行代码审核,确保无漏洞后进行部署。 - **后续修改与**:根据实际使用情况,对智能合约进行调整和。 #### 咨询服务很多企业在进入区块链领域时往往缺乏相关的知识和经验,这时区块链公司的咨询服务便显得尤为重要。咨询服务可以帮助企业理解区块链技术的本质,分析其在业务中应用的可行性。
咨询服务通常包括:
- **技术趋势分析**:提供区块链行业的发展动向,帮助企业把握技术趋势。 - **实施方案制定**:根据企业的具体需求,制定切实可行的区块链实施方案。 - **风险评估与管理**:对潜在风险进行评估,并提出相应的管理策略。 #### 技术支持与维护区块链项目的上线并不是结束,后续的技术支持与维护也是至关重要的。区块链公司可以为客户提供持续的技术支持,确保系统的稳定和高效运作。
技术支持服务包括:
- **系统监控与报警**:实时监控系统运行状态,及时发现并解决问题。 - **常规维护与更新**:定期对系统进行维护和更新,确保其性能。 - **故障排除**:快速响应客户的技术请求,解决故障和问题。 #### 系统集成在推动区块链应用的过程中,区块链系统往往需要与现有的IT基础设施进行无缝集成。这就需要专业的系统集成服务以确保不同系统之间的兼容与协同作用。
系统集成服务包括:
- **需求分析**:评估现有系统与区块链的兼容性需求。 - **接口开发**:为现有系统与区块链环境创建有效接口。 - **数据迁移与同步**:确保数据在新的区块链系统与现有系统之间的无缝迁移与同步。 ### 外包业务的潜在挑战 尽管区块链公司的外包业务带来了诸多便利,但在实际操作中也面临一些挑战: 1. **技术门槛**:区块链技术相对复杂,高质量的开发和咨询服务需要具备扎实的技术基础和丰富的经验。 2. **安全性问题**:区块链本身具备高度的安全性,但在外包过程中,数据的保护及合约的安全性仍然是企业所关注的重点。 3. **法律和合规风险**:区块链行业的监管政策尚不完善,外包公司需要确保其服务符合通过市场监管要求。 4. **沟通障碍**:由于技术复杂性,企业在外包过程中和服务提供商之间的沟通可能会出现误解。 5. **成本控制**:外包业务虽然可以节约成本,但在选择合作伙伴时,过低的价格可能会影响服务质量。 ### 未来展望 随着区块链技术的持续发展与普及,区块链公司的外包业务将会迎来更加广阔的发展前景。从金融领域的创新,到供应链的透明化,再到医疗健康的管理,区块链的应用场景不断扩大,外包已经不是一个单纯的选择,而是革命性变革的一部分。 ### 常见问题 #### 1. 区块链外包业务的成本与价值如何评估?在进行区块链外包时,企业常常关注外包成本和获得的业务价值。评估成本时,不仅要考虑直接费用,如开发成本和管理费用,还应考虑时间成本、后续维护成本等。
评价外包业务的价值时,则需要结合企业的特定需求和实际业务效益进行分析。例如,通过外包获得的技术可能加速了产品上市,增强了市场竞争力,这些都是外包带来的价值
结合这些因素,企业可以更全面地评估区块链外包的成本与收益,从而做出更加明智的决策。
#### 2. 如何选择合适的区块链外包服务提供商?选择合适的区块链外包服务提供商是一项至关重要的任务。为了找到最佳合作伙伴,企业需要考虑以下几个关键因素:
- **技术能力**:评估服务提供商的技术水平和成功案例,确保其在区块链领域的专业性。 - **团队经验**:考虑外包公司团队的背景和经验,特别是在与企业类似领域的经验。 - **客户反馈**:寻找第三方平台或直接联系以前的客户,了解他们对服务提供商的评价。 - **安全保障措施**:了解服务提供商在数据和系统安全方面所采取的措施,确保企业的敏感信息得到保护。 - **沟通能力**:良好的沟通是合作成功的关键,选择能够理解企业需求并进行有效沟通的团队将大大降低合作风险。经过综合评估,企业可以选择出最适合自己需求的服务商,从而保障项目的顺利推进。
#### 3. 外包区块链开发时如何保证质量和安全性?在选择外包区块链开发时,保证质量和安全性是关键的考虑因素。企业可以采取以下措施:
- **签署合同**:确保与外包方签署详细的合同,明确项目目标、开发标准、验收流程和责任。 - **阶段性审核**:将项目划分为多个阶段,进行定期审核和评估,及时发现问题并调整开发方向。 - **引入第三方审计**:在区块链应用正式上线之前,引入专业的第三方审计公司进行系统安全和功能的审核,确保其符合行业标准。 - **安全培训**:为外包团队提供必要的安全培训,提高他们在处理敏感信息时的安全意识。通过这些措施,企业能够更好地控制外包项目的质量和安全性,降低风险。
#### 4. 区块链外包对企业内部团队会产生哪些影响?区块链外包不仅能为企业提供技术支持,还可能深刻影响企业内部团队的运作模式:
- **角色重组**:外包可能会导致企业内部角色的重组,现有的团队成员需要重新调整工作重点,从技术实施转向项目管理或战略规划。 - **技能提升**:与外包团队的合作中,企业团队成员可能会获取先进的技术知识,提高自身技能水平。 - **工作流程**:外包合作会促使企业内部工作流程的,推动团队提高效率和专业性。企业应积极管理这些变化,确保外包不仅成就项目成功,同时也能促进内部团队的成长与发展。
#### 5. 区块链外包项目的常见风险有哪些,该如何应对?区块链外包项目可能面临多种风险,包括技术风险、合约风险、法律合规风险等。为有效应对这些风险,企业可以采取以下措施:
- **技术评估**:在项目前期做好技术评估,确保外包公司的技术能力与项目需求相匹配。 - **合约条款制定**:制定良好的合约条款,尤其是关于安全、知识产权和保密的部分,确保双方权益得到保障。 - **法律咨询**:聘请专业法律顾问,确保项目遵循相关法律法规,减少合规风险。通过做好风控管理,企业可以降低风险,确保外包项目的顺利实施,为未来的腾飞铺平道路。
总的来说,区块链公司的外包业务正在成为推动行业创新与发展的重要力量。随着技术的不断进步和市场需求的提升,外包的业务前景将愈加广阔。